Mumbai: An issue of non-availability of a toilet in house has created rift between Indian couple which has been resolved with a promise to construct a proper toilet.
A 27-year-old, Savita, wife of Devkaran Malviya leave her husband with two kids with a demand to construct washroom, otherwise she will not come.
Savita has agreed to return to her husband’s home at a village in Dewas district, after he promised before a court to get a proper toilet constructed at his place.
Later, she filed a case in a local court seeking monthly maintenance from her husband. During the course of the case, it came to light that she had a dispute with her husband over their being no proper toilet facility in his house.
She told the magistrate court recently that she would not go to her husband’s home unless a proper toilet was built there.
The husband has assured the court he will ensure that a toilet is in place before next hearing which will be on January 10.
